Williams Lake Plywood, A division of West Fraser Mills Ltd. has an excellent career opportunity for a:
CHIEF STEAM ENGINEER
Reporting to the Maintenance Superintendent, the Chief Steam Engineer is responsible for all aspects of the operation of the Steam Plant including two 40,000-lb/hr Hog Fired Boilers and Steam Systems in our Plywood Plant in Williams Lake, B.C.
The responsibilities will also include the maintenance and improvements to the Steam Plant. The Plywood Plant runs continuously 7 days a week with state of the art equipment and producing 260m sq ft of 3/8 plywood per year. The Chief Steam Engineer will utilize a crew compliment of 13.
The successful candidate must have a 2nd Class ticket, several years of “hands-on” maintenance experience, and be a self-starter who gets along well with others. This is a salary position with a comprehensive wage and benefits package including a defined benefit pension plan.
